mick softley: songs for the swining survivor

First released in autumn 1965. It was never subsequently reissued. This debut is also notable as one of the first UK singer/songwriter folk albums in the contemporary style pioneered earlier in the U.S. by Bob Dylan. Comparisons with early period Donovan are also perhaps inevitable. Donovan cited Mick Softley as a major influence and Softley actually wrote a few songs which were covered by Donovan. Notably 'The War Drags On', which Donovan included on his 'Universal Soldier' EP, and which is featured here in its original version. Rarity value aside, this album also represents an integral piece of the whole UK 60s folk-rock jigsaw. In its way as important as debut albums by Donovan, Bert Jansch and Jackson C Frank. And this album, more than any, conveys the spirit of those first guitar-strumming pioneers. Also included on this album are Softley's interpretations of the Billie Holiday favourite, 'Strange Fruit', and Woody Guthrie's 'The Plains of the Buffalo'"
